    Exemplars of Altruism
    We shall show all the true purpose of this world.

    History: Little is known about the origins of this mysterious organization. They claim to have been formed by a man known only as "Axon," who revered almost as a deity among the Exemplars. Their first activity began about 250 years before the present day. Since that day, reports of Exemplar activity has only increased, at a rate which alarms the various heads of society.

    Structure: The members of this group, known as Exemplars, maintain a fairly loose hierarchy. At the head sits the Paragon, who oversees all activity among the lesser Exemplars. However, many of the more menial tasks are delegated to the three Epitomes, the members ranked directly below. They often curry favors and manipulate their underlings, in an attempt to place themselves ahead of their peers, for whoever is in favor when the current Paragon dies becomes the new head, and directly appoint his successor to the Epitomes. Each Epitome oversees one of the three Archetype groups that make up the rest of the organization.

    Joining: To join the Exemplars of Altruism, you must prove yourself worthy of becoming the embodiment of their ideals. This usually involves completing a series of rituals and trials, randomly selected by the Epitome overseeing them. Should one succeed, you shall be inducted. If you fail, however, the Epitome shall punish you for wasting valuable time. Fortunately, said punishments are not usually lethal.

    Duties: The Exemplars of Altruism abide by the rhetoric of assisting the world to become stronger. However, their methods for completing this goal are... questionable at best. And at worst, there are many who believe that this so-called goal is merely an act to disguise their true intentions. Regardless, it is fairly obvious that they believe that strength comes from trials and tribulation. The Exemplars often initiate unfortunate events and fund the shadier aspects of society, only to then alert authorities and adventurers so they may attempt to prevent widespread chaos and destruction.

    Perception: Most look down upon the Exemplars for one reason or another. Exact opinions range from radical extremists, to misguided philanthropists, and even to terrorists. However, there are more than a few who seem to agree with the Exemplars...

    Occulta Ludum
    Does anyone know where Professor Aphalia's Intro to Divination is? Or when?

    History: The Occulta Ludum is the premiere school of divination magics in the world. Or it would be, if anyone could find it. Founded long ago by an archmage of irrepressible power and foresight, the school was intended to bring together the best and brightest diviners in order to use their power and foresight to chart the ideal course for the world. Naturally, the barrier for entry needed to be appreciably high, so a great working of magic was constructed to prevent people from learning of the Occulta Ludum without first being capable of divining its existence. Sadly, it seems the magic was a bit too effective, and as a result, even once members have successfully joined, they find it extremely difficult to learn anything about the school.

    Structure: Presumably, the Occulta Ludum is structured like most other universities. Students sign up for classes, attend lectures and advance their knowledge and skill with divination and other magic. Unfortunately, given the nature of the Occulta Ludum's protections, very few people actually remember anything about the lectures they attended, or if they even attended them at all. So no one can actually be sure what happened.

    Joining: Those that actually manage to remember that they've joined the Occulta Ludum say that the process is fairly easy. Classes are expensive, but the only actual barrier to entry is the ability to locate the Occulta Ludum. What is more amusing is those students (and professors!) who join the Occulta Ludum without even realizing they've done so. Fragmented accounts of job interviews, ritual hazing, welcome and "spirit" weeks, and an intense fear of upcoming "Finals" haunt these poor souls for years at a time, sometimes even decades in the cases of those who are pursued by some beast referred to as a "post-doc."

    Duties: The general mission of the Occulta Ludum is clear: To advance the study and practice of divination magic. Specific duties, however, are much more confusing and difficult to grasp in any meaningful way as they too are affected by the protective magics that hide the Occulta Ludum from the eyes of mere mortals. Still, the usual duties of raiding ancient tombs, scouring forgotten libraries and attending sporting events (Go Fighting Fugue States!) are common.

    Perception: Almost no one outside the Occultua Ludum itself is aware of the school, and so it has almost no presence in the public mind. Among the other great schools of magical learning, the few who are aware of the Occulta Ludum consider it something of a joke, though they can't easily deny the notable talents of its supposed graduates in the art of divination.

    The Free Blades

    Symbol: Three intersecting weapons, at least one of which must be a sword.

    Background, Goals, and Dreams: The Free Blades are a network of loosely affiliated mercenary companies. Theirs is less a rigid, hierarchical order and more a seal of quality - those who bear the mark of the Free Blades are known to be warriors of skill and professionalism. The organization itself maintains no particular moral or ethical requirements, nor indeed does it demand much of its members. Its only requirements are that members fulfill their contracts to the best of their abilities, that they not disgrace the Free Blades, and that they pursue martial prowess over other things. (Spellcasting is permitted, as every Free Blade is free to pursue his contracts as he pleases, but those who dedicate themselves to spellcasting over martial combat are disfavored.) Members are also expected to pay a small tithe, in return for which they may use the mark of the association, and have access to Free Blades resources worldwide.

    Type: Fighting company.

    Scale: 9 (regional/barony). Although the Free Blades are widespread and well-known, they are not particularly influential.

    Affiliation Score Criteria: A character cannot become a member of the Free Blades if he has any levels in a class that can learn 9th-level spells. If he takes an archetype that reduces his ultimate spellcasting progression, he may qualify as a member of the Free Blades. A character who is a member of the Free Blades and subsequently takes levels in a class that can learn 9th-level spells will remain recognized by the Free Blades, and may still draw on whatever benefits have accrued to him, but may no longer advance in the organization, and may not represent himself as a member nor use the mark of the Free Blades.

    Criterion Affiliation Score Modifier
    Character Level 1/2 PC's level
    Proficiency with Weapons +1 for each Weapon Group
    Levels in Martial Initiator Class +1/2 per level (round down)
    5 or more ranks in Knowleedge (martial) +1
    10 or more ranks in Knowledge (martial) +2
    Paid tithes regularly +1 per year
    Took on a major contract that brought prestige to the Free Blades +2 (-4 if you fail)

    Titles, Benefits, and Duties: New members of the Free Blades have relatively few obligations, but little access to benefits. More senior members enjoy no new obligations, but greater access to the guild's benefits. All members, irrespective of title, are obligated to tithe 10% of their annual earnings to the organization, to a minimum of 10 gp. Although the tithes are not rigorously audited, a member who continuously tithes little may be investigated; those who are concealing their income from the Free Blades will be stripped of rank and privileges, while those who simply don't earn enough will be gently encouraged to either work harder or retire. Retired Free Blades may enjoy any of the benefits that have accrued to them, but may not advance in the organization, and may not represent themselves as members nor use the mark of the Free Blades.

    Affiliation Score Title: Benefits and Duties
    3 or lower Greenhorn: Junior member with no benefits.
    4-10 Rookie: +1 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(martial) rolls, +2 circumstance bonus to all Diplomacy rolls with other Free Blades, and access to low-level contracts through the Free Blades.
    11-15 Tested Rookie: +2 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(martial) rolls, +1 circumstance bonus to all attack and damage rolls, +4 circumstance bonus to all Diplomacy rolls with other Free Blades, access to low- and mid-level contracts.
    16-22 Veteran: +3 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(martial) rolls, +2 circumstance bonus to all attack and damage rolls, +6 circumstance bonus to all Diplomacy rolls with other Free Blades, access to low-, mid-, and high-level contracts. You may purchase weapon and armor crafting services through the guild at a 10% discount.
    23-29 Seasoned Veteran: +4 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(martial) rolls, +4 circumstance bonus to all attack and damage rolls, +1 circumstance bonus to all saving throws, +8 circumstance bonus to all Diplomacy rolls with other Free Blades, access to any contracts available through the Free Blades. You may purchase weapon and armor crafting services through the guild at a 20% discount. If you hire other Free Blades (at DM discretion), you may receive a 10% discount on their contract.
    30 or higher Ancient Blade: +5 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(martial) rolls, +6 circumstance bonus to all attack and damage rolls, +3 circumstance bonus to all saving throws, +10 circumstance bonus to all Diplomacy rolls with other Free Blades, access to any contracts available through the Free Blades. You may purchase weapon and armor crafting services at a 25% discount. If you hire other Free Blades (at DM discretion), you may receive a 20% discount on their contract.
    Unless otherwise stated, the benefits above are not cumulative.

    Executive Powers: Craft, crusade, gift.

    Altova Martialis
    "Strength must come in all aspects, mental and physical. Your wit must be as strong as your arms and as sharp as your steel." - Unknown, Altova Martialis Grand Marshall

    History
    Founded by a group of scholar-warriors, the Altova Martialis is both a school of thought and physical academy heavily focused on the self-perfection to be found in studying the arts of war. Over the course of it's history, it has produced many of the world's finest tacticians and warriors to ever grace the battlefield. Many alumni of the Altova Martialis have also gone on their way to create new academies, even new styles of fighting, all in the name of perfecting the martial spirit.

    Structure
    The academy of Altova Martialis is loosely structured, focused less on strict hierarchy than on friendly competition over martial and mental prowess, headed by an elected Grand Marshall, who serves as a liaison to the outside world and director of day-to-day studies and training. Students are given lessons on many forms combat, ranging over a variety of weapons, from traditional single swords to heavy waraxes, spears, and even bows and slings, as well as philosophical lessons, honing their mind on historical texts regarding anything from tactics and historical battles to biology, anatomy, and even art.

    Joining
    Joining the Altova Martialis is quite simple. Anyone may join, provided they demonstrate the capacity and will to hone their combat skills and their mind. Even a simple farm boy may be chosen over a prince or noble, no matter the difference in the fighting prowess or equipment used by the two.

    Duties
    A student of Altova Martialis must always seek to better their mind and their body through their study and combat, and to uphold both their honor and the academy's.

    Perception
    Altova Martialis has gained a reputation of producing the brightest tacticians and the strongest warriors in every corner of the world. Many child academies have also been founded in the name of Altova Martialis, generally by Alumni and 'Graduates' of the Academy.

    The Claws of Io

    Symbol: Five draconic claws, one of each color of True Dragon; Good members use metallic colors, Evil members use chromatic.

    Background, Goals, and Dreams: The Claws of Io are a secret affiliation of ancient and powerful Dragons. Their organization transcends philosophy, ideology, and alignment; they convene for the purpose of advancing Dragonkind among the planes. Their agendas are varied and nuanced, their plans centuries in execution. Most members are not fully aware of the organizations goals and means; some are even unaware that they work for any kind of organization. New recruits are selected, groomed, and utilized without their knowledge; frequently potential candidates are employed through a network of intermediaries. Those who prove themselves useful, valuable, and discrete, may eventually become aware of some larger body that they serve, although the extent of the organization will remain unknown to them for many, many years. Many members of the Claws of Io are unaware even that the organization has both Good and Evil Dragons in its employ, instead believing that the opposing number is somehow a perversion or enemy of their order. The leaders of the organization, known as the Ten Tyrants, prefer this - setting Good Dragon against Evil Dragon is the way of their race, after all, and promotes strength among them.

    The organization is structured hierarchically. At the top are the Ten Tyrants, choice representatives of one of each of the ten colors of True Dragon, each a Great Wyrm in age. Each is served by Ten Talons, ten specifically chosen subordinates. Each Tyrant chooses his own Talons from among his own race. The Talons are carefully groomed and prepared for potential leadership, over many centuries; each Talon is at least a Wyrm in age. Chief among the Talons' privileges is the right to challenge a Tyrant for his position of leadership, in a challenge of the Tyrant's choosing. Only the Ten Tyrants and their Talons are aware of the full scope of the organization.

    Below the Talons are a network of informants, servants, employees, spies, and unwitting pawns, all of whom are True Dragons, with the exception of the Shells. Shells are non-members who are used by the organization, unwittingly, to forward the aims of Dragonkind. The organizational structures vary in accordance with their color - Gold Dragon organizations tend to be hierarchical, while Black Dragon organizations tend to be more loosely affiliated. All, however, serve the ultimate aims of the Claws of Io.

    Type: Cabal (racial).

    Scale: 19 (multiplanar). The Claws of Io are many, and their influence spans the planes. Some even claim to have the ears of godlings.

    Affiliation Score Criteria: A character cannot become a member of the Claws of Io unless he is a True Dragon. A character's advancement within the Claws is limited by his Draconic age; advancement is given only to those who have lived many, many years.

    Criterion Affiliation Score Modifier
    Draconic RHD 1/2 RHD
    Value of Hoard +1 per 20,000 gp
    Ranks in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) +1/4 per rank, rounded down
    5 or more combined ranks in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) +1
    10 or more combined ranks in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) +2
    Knowingly performed a minor task for the Claws of Io +1 (-2 if you fail)
    Knowingly performed a major task for the Claws of Io +2 (-4 if you fail)

    Titles, Benefits, and Duties: Members of the Claws of Io do not owe tithes or duties in the traditional sense. What they owe is a dual obligation of total obedience and total discretion. Insubordination is punishable by immediate execution, a task carried out even by the most noble and Good dragons, as the organization's aims take precedent over any individual member's life. And no creature, not even Dragons, may become aware of the organization's existence; indiscretion results in the execution of the errant member, as well as any creature to whom they might have disclosed their knowledge.

    Affiliation Score Title: Benefits and Duties Draconic Age Requirement
    3 or lower No rank. In fact, at rank 3 or lower, a member is unaware that he even serves the organization. Must be a True Dragon of at least Adult age.
    4-10 Dreaming: +2 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), Knowledge (the planes), and Spellcraft rolls, +2 circumstance bonus to the save DC of your Frightful Presence. Must be a True Dragon of at least Mature Adult age.
    11-15 Sleeping: +4 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) rolls, +4 circumstance bonus to the save DC of your Frightful Presence, +1 circumstance bonus to your spell resistance and damage reduction. Must be a True Dragon of at least Old age.
    16-22 Awakened: +6 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) rolls, +6 circumstance bonus to the save DC of your Frightful Presence, +2 circumstance bonus to your spell resistance and damage reduction, and treat yourself as one age category higher for the purposes of calculating your breath weapon's damage and save DC. Must be a True Dragon of at least Very Old age.
    23-29 Learned: +8 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) rolls, +8 circumstance bonus to the save DC of your Frightful Presence, +4 circumstance bonus to your spell resistance and damage reduction, treat yourself as two age categories higher for the purposes of calculating your breath weapon's damage and save DC, and +1 circumstance bonus to your CL for all spells and spell-like abilities and effects. Must be a True Dragon of at least Ancient age.
    30 or higher Enlightened: +10 circumstance bonus on all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(religion), and Knowledge (the planes) rolls, +10 circumstance bonus to the save DC of your Frightful Presence, +8 circumstance bonus to your spell resistance and damage reduction, treat yourself as three age categories higher for the purposes of calculating your breath weapon's damage and save DC, and +2 circumstance bonus to your CL for all spells and spell-like abilities and effects. Additionally, treat yourself as if you have gained an additional level in any one spellcasting class you have taken, for purposes of spells known/prepared and caster level. Alternatively, or if you have not taken any spellcasting class levels, you may treat your effective Sorcerer level as one higher. Must be a True Dragon of at least Wyrm age.
    Unless otherwise stated, the benefits above are not cumulative.

    Executive Powers: Gift, harvest, shadow war.
